Group: capability_videoin_c<0~(n-1)> n denotes the value of "capability_nvideoin"
PARAMETER
VALUE
SECURITY
(get/set)
DESCRIPTION
lens_type
fisheye, fixed,
varifocal,
changeable,
motor, ics,-
<product
dependent>
0/7
The lens type of this channel.
"fisheye": Fisheye lens
"fixed": Build-in fixed-focus lens.
"varifocal": Build-in varifocal lens.
"changeable": changeable lens. Like
box-type camera, users can install any
C-Mount or CS-Mount lens as they wish.
"motor": Lens with motor to support zoom,
focus, etc.
"ics": An i-CS lens is an intelligent CS-mount
lens that contains information about,
among other things, its own geometrical
distortion and the exact position of its
zoom, focus, and iris opening.
"-": N/A
* Only available when [httpversion] >=
0301a
color_support
<boolean>
0/7
1 : camera can select to display color or
black/white video streams.
0: camera do not support this feature.
* We support this parameter when the
version number (httpversion) is equal or
greater than 0310a.
eptz_zoomratio
<string>
0/7
Indicate the support zoom ratio of eptz.
"-": not support ePTZ
* We support this parameter when the
version number (httpversion) is equal or
greater than 0310a.
rotation
<boolean>
0/7
Indicate current mode whether support
video rotation

rotationaffect -
<product
dependent>
0/7 When rotation is enabled, some features
may become malfunction or be forced to a
given value. The affected functions are list
here.
The format is "Affect API
name":"Policy":"Description"
"Policy" can be categorized into following
groups:
- (disabled) : UI turns grey and users can't
select it.
-
(unchanged) : UI keeps the status as before
and user can't change it.
- (hidden) : UI is hidden.
- (fixed) : UI is fixed to one selection or
value.
- (ranged) : UI is fixed to multiple selections
or values.
- (enabled) : UI is checked.
- (notsupport) : the affected function is not
available.
"Affect API name" can be described in
hierarchy, such as
"exposurewin.mode.blc:disabled:" which
means blc exposure window is disabled. API
name can be one word as well, such as
"exposurelevel:fixed:6" which means
exposurelevel is fixed to level 6.
"Description" can be a nonnegative integer
or string or NULL.
"-" means no feature is affected.
* When "rotation"=0, this value must be "-"
* We support this parameter when the
version number (httpversion) is equal or
greater than 0304b.
